Adapted from an 18th-century Neapolitan Christmas créche.

Anyone who has visited the Metropolitan Museum of Art in New York around the holidays has marveled at its giant Christmas tree and the creche that is diplayed among its branches.

This delighful book brings to life that Neapolitan creche. In four colorful panels, angels, shepherds, magi, Virgin and Child are depicted in wonderful watercolors by Borje Svensson and marvelous paper engineering by James Roger Diaz.

Johanna Hecht's Neapolitan creche commentary is a great addition to this lovely edition.


Published by Delacorte Press; 8" x 11.75"; 32" wide x 11.75" high x 5" deep opened
